Three Things You Should Try Before You Call A Repair Technician To Fix Your Dishwasher

If your dishwasher is not working properly, the first thing that comes to mind is calling an appliance repair company. But before you do that, there are a few quick fixes that may work for you. The following are a few things to try.

What to try if the dishwasher isn't filling up with water

If your dishwasher does not fill up with water, then you need to check the float. As your dishwasher begins to fill up, the float begins to rise. When it reaches a certain level, the dishwasher will shut off the water. This is similar to the way a toilet tank fills up with water. It, too, has a float. What can happen in your dishwasher is that something can get stuck underneath the float. Your dishwasher thinks it's filled with water. All you need to do is slide the bottom rack out, identify the float, and see if there's anything stuck under it. The float is usually made of plastic and is often in one of the bottom corners.

What to try if the dishwasher isn't draining

This is a clogged drain line from your dishwasher to your sink's drain pipe. Look under your sink, and you will notice a tube connected to your drain pipe. The tube is fastened with a clamp that tightens with a screw. Simply loosen the screw and pull the tube from the drain pipe. The clog will be at the openings of the drain pipe or the tube. You can clean this gunk out with your screwdriver. Then, slide the tube back on the drain pipe, and tighten the screw clamp.

What to try if the dishwasher isn't cleaning your dishes well

There can be many reasons for this, and many of the fixes are not quick. However, you can clean important parts of the dishwasher, starting with the spray arm. After taking out the bottom rack, you can then remove the spray arm, according to your owner's manual. There are several holes that you can clean out with something strong and narrow, such as an ice pick. Use soap and clean the exterior of the spray arm with a soft brush. Next, remove the filters and clean them. There is usually a large, plastic disk or partial disk that sits around the spray arm. There is also a smaller mesh filter that can get dirty. After putting everything back, you can then remove the top rack and spray arm, cleaning it the same way as the bottom spray arm.

The above quick fixes relate to a dirty dishwasher, so if one of them works, you need to start using a dishwasher cleaning product once a month.
